PAUL LAWRIE ONLY TWO SHOTS
 
 OFF PACE IN SOUTH AFRICA

By COLIN FARQUHARSON
Paul Lawrie is in joint 11th place, but only two strokes behind four joint leaders, with one round to do in the South African Sunshine Tour's Dimension Data pro-am at the Montagu Courses, Fancourt.
Lawrie has had three rounds of 69, the last of which today (Sat) was bogey free. His second 69 was over a par-73 links course.
The Aberdonian is on 10-under-par 207.
Sharing the lead on 12-under 205 are England's Chris Lloyd and three South Africans, George Coetzee, Chris Swanepoel and Jean Hugo.
Blairgowrie's Bradley Neil made the cut after a 74 for 216 but compatriots Ross Kellett and David Law missed out on 218.
